GSA Public Buildings Service The U.S. Government is seeking competitive lease proposals for new and/or continuing leasing opportunities through the Leasing Portal. Award under this RLP will be made to the lowest-priced, technically acceptable negotiated offer.

  • City:  Lewiston
  • State:  Idaho
  • Delineated Area:  City limits of Lewiston
  • Minimum ABOA Square Feet:  3,784 ABOA SF
  • Maximum ABOA Square Feet:  4,162 ABOA SF
  • Space Type:  Office, Retail
  • Parking: 0
  • Lease Term:
  • Full Term:  15 Years
  • Firm Term:  10 Years Firm
  • Amortization Term:  10 years for both Tenant Improvements and Building Specific Amortized Capital.

AGENCY UNIQUE REQUIREMENTS

Agency Tenant Improvement Allowance:

$53.65 per ABOA SF Building Specific Amortized Capital (BSAC): $12.00 per ABOA SF

Additional Requirements:

  • One (1) public transportation stop must be located within 1,600 walkable linear feet of the building’s public entrance.
  • Space must not be on the same property as establishments primarily involved in the sale of alcohol or the sale and discharge of firearms.
  • Minimum 20 feet column spacing (center-on-center) and from any interior wall.
  • Must be one (1) contiguous space on a single floor with no interior steps, ramps, and cannot be separated by any common areas.
  • Any space being offered for consideration that is not located on the ground floor must provide two elevators (One passenger and one freight elevator).
  • Space must be no more than twice as long as wide.
  • If applicable, provide history or all history of water/moisture intrusion or mold; must provide remediation history and evidence of remediation, including source corrections, repeated issues or interference with tenant’s quiet enjoyment may result in disqualification.
  • 24/7/365 temperature-controlled server room
  • Must provide the Government with parking that meets or exceeds all applicable local zoning requirements.
  • Security Level II

HOW TO OFFER Unless otherwise authorized by the LCO or his/her designated representative, offers may only be submitted electronically to GSA using the Requirement Specific Acquisition Platform (RSAP) located at https://leasing.gsa.gov.  RSAP enables Offerors to electronically offer space for lease to the Federal Government.  The offer submission process is web-enabled, allowing all registered participants to submit and update offers to lease space to the Government in response to a single RLP for a specific space requirement.  Lease awards will be made to the lowest-priced, technically acceptable offer without negotiations. Offered space must comply with all applicable Federal, State, and Local jurisdiction requirements, including standards for fire and life safety, accessibility, seismic resilience, and energy efficiency. In order to be considered for award, offers conforming to the requirements of the RLP shall be submitted through LOP/RSAP no later than September 30, 2026, 5:00 PM PDT. Offerors must submit all documentation identified in this RLP using RSAP.  RSAP generates the Lessor's Annual Cost Statement (GSA Form 1217) and Proposal to Lease Space (GSA Form 1364) based on the Offeror’s inputs to the online workflow.  These auto-populated forms are available for review on the attachments page of the RSAP workflow and are automatically included as part of the offer upon submission; there is no need for the Offeror to manually complete the attached blank version of these two forms.  Offerors can revise the auto-generated GSA Form 1217 and/or GSA Form 1364 by changing the inputs to the online workflow.  Any subsequent revisions to offer documents must be submitted through RSAP.  There is no paper-based submission process under this RLP and paper submissions will not be considered, unless otherwise authorized by the LCO.
